Comic Cinema Crew - The Death of the Incredible Hulk

The Death of the Incredible Hulk

02/06/19 • 75 min

Comic Cinema Crew

This week we watched "The Death of the Incredible" franchise and the made-for-TV movie with the same title. Once again the Crew finds themselves in agreement that another character has all the most interesting bits of a Hulk move. Join Producer James, George, and Meghan and we pay our respects for this Marvel TV franchise.
